Class TextComponentHoverAndClickEventFix

java.lang.Object
com.mojang.datafixers.DataFix
net.minecraft.datafixer.fix.TextComponentHoverAndClickEventFix

public class TextComponentHoverAndClickEventFix extends com.mojang.datafixers.DataFix
Mappings:
Namespace Name
named net/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ix
intermediary net/minecraft/class_10568
official bki
  • Constructor Summary Link icon

    Constructors
    Constructor
    Description
    TextComponentHoverAndClickEventFix(com.mojang.datafixers.schemas.Schema outputSchema)
     
  • Method Summary Link icon

    Modifier and Type
    Method
    Description
    protected com.mojang.datafixers.TypeRewriteRule
     
    private <C1, C2, H extends com.mojang.datafixers.util.Pair<String, ?>>
    com.mojang.datafixers.TypeRewriteRule
    method_66120(com.mojang.datafixers.types.Type<C1> type, com.mojang.datafixers.types.Type<C2> type2, com.mojang.datafixers.types.Type<H> type3)
     
    private static com.mojang.serialization.Dynamic<?>
    method_66125(com.mojang.serialization.Dynamic<?> dynamic)
     
    private static com.mojang.serialization.Dynamic<?>
    method_66126(com.mojang.serialization.Dynamic<?> dynamic, com.mojang.serialization.Dynamic<?> dynamic2, String[] string)
     
    private static boolean
     
    private static com.mojang.serialization.Dynamic<?>
    method_66128(com.mojang.serialization.Dynamic<?> dynamic)
     
    private static boolean
     
    private static <T> @Nullable com.mojang.serialization.Dynamic<T>
    method_66130(com.mojang.serialization.Dynamic<T> dynamic)
     
    private static @Nullable Integer
    method_66131(com.mojang.serialization.Dynamic<?> dynamic)
     

    Methods inherited from class com.mojang.datafixers.DataFix Link icon

    checked, convertUnchecked,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here, fixTypeEverywhereTyped, fixTypeEverywhereTyped, fixTypeEverywhereTyped, fixTypeEverywhereTyped, getInputSchema, getOutputSchema, getRule, getVersionKey, onFail, writeAndRead, writeFixAndRead

    Methods inherited from class java.lang.Object Link icon

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details Link icon

    • TextComponentHoverAndClickEventFix Link icon

      public TextComponentHoverAndClickEventFix(com.mojang.datafixers.schemas.Schema outputSchema)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;<init>(Lcom/mojang/datafixers/schemas/Schema;)V
      intermediary <init> Lnet/minecraft/class_10568;<init>(Lcom/mojang/datafixers/schemas/Schema;)V
      official <init> Lbki;<init>(Lcom/mojang/datafixers/schemas/Schema;)V
  • Method Details Link icon

    • makeRule Link icon

      protected com.mojang.datafixers.TypeRewriteRule makeRule()
      Specified by:
      makeRule in class com.mojang.datafixers.DataFix
    • method_66120 Link icon

      private <C1, C2, H extends com.mojang.datafixers.util.Pair<String, ?>> com.mojang.datafixers.TypeRewriteRule method_66120(com.mojang.datafixers.types.Type<C1> type, com.mojang.datafixers.types.Type<C2> type2, com.mojang.datafixers.types.Type<H> type3)
      Mappings:
      Namespace Name Mixin selector
      named method_66120 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66120(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;)Lcom/mojang/datafixers/TypeRewriteRule;
      intermediary method_66120 Lnet/minecraft/class_10568;method_66120(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;)Lcom/mojang/datafixers/TypeRewriteRule;
      official a Lbki;a(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;Lcom/mojang/datafixers/types/Type;)Lcom/mojang/datafixers/TypeRewriteRule;
    • method_66125 Link icon

      private static com.mojang.serialization.Dynamic<?> method_66125(com.mojang.serialization.Dynamic<?> dynamic)
      Mappings:
      Namespace Name Mixin selector
      named method_66125 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66125(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      intermediary method_66125 Lnet/minecraft/class_10568;method_66125(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      official a Lbki;a(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
    • method_66126 Link icon

      private static com.mojang.serialization.Dynamic<?> method_66126(com.mojang.serialization.Dynamic<?> dynamic, com.mojang.serialization.Dynamic<?> dynamic2, String[] string)
      Mappings:
      Namespace Name Mixin selector
      named method_66126 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66126(Lcom/mojang/serialization/Dynamic;Lcom/mojang/serialization/Dynamic;[Ljava/lang/String;)Lcom/mojang/serialization/Dynamic;
      intermediary method_66126 Lnet/minecraft/class_10568;method_66126(Lcom/mojang/serialization/Dynamic;Lcom/mojang/serialization/Dynamic;[Ljava/lang/String;)Lcom/mojang/serialization/Dynamic;
      official a Lbki;a(Lcom/mojang/serialization/Dynamic;Lcom/mojang/serialization/Dynamic;[Ljava/lang/String;)Lcom/mojang/serialization/Dynamic;
    • method_66128 Link icon

      private static com.mojang.serialization.Dynamic<?> method_66128(com.mojang.serialization.Dynamic<?> dynamic)
      Mappings:
      Namespace Name Mixin selector
      named method_66128 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66128(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      intermediary method_66128 Lnet/minecraft/class_10568;method_66128(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      official b Lbki;b(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
    • method_66130 Link icon

      @Nullable private static <T> @Nullable com.mojang.serialization.Dynamic<T> method_66130(com.mojang.serialization.Dynamic<T> dynamic)
      Mappings:
      Namespace Name Mixin selector
      named method_66130 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66130(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      intermediary method_66130 Lnet/minecraft/class_10568;method_66130(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
      official c Lbki;c(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
    • method_66131 Link icon

      @Nullable private static @Nullable Integer method_66131(com.mojang.serialization.Dynamic<?> dynamic)
      Mappings:
      Namespace Name Mixin selector
      named method_66131 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66131(Lcom/mojang/serialization/Dynamic;)Ljava/lang/Integer;
      intermediary method_66131 Lnet/minecraft/class_10568;method_66131(Lcom/mojang/serialization/Dynamic;)Ljava/lang/Integer;
      official d Lbki;d(Lcom/mojang/serialization/Dynamic;)Ljava/lang/Integer;
    • method_66127 Link icon

      private static boolean method_66127(String string)
      Mappings:
      Namespace Name Mixin selector
      named method_66127 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66127(Ljava/lang/String;)Z
      intermediary method_66127 Lnet/minecraft/class_10568;method_66127(Ljava/lang/String;)Z
      official a Lbki;a(Ljava/lang/String;)Z
    • method_66129 Link icon

      private static boolean method_66129(String string)
      Mappings:
      Namespace Name Mixin selector
      named method_66129 Lnet/minecraft/datafixer/fix/TextComponentHoverAndClickEventFix;method_66129(Ljava/lang/String;)Z
      intermediary method_66129 Lnet/minecraft/class_10568;method_66129(Ljava/lang/String;)Z
      official b Lbki;b(Ljava/lang/String;)Z